Episode Summary
Executive Summary: Neil deGrasse Tyson and David Grinspoon discuss a Bill Maher interview covering science education, politics, religion, abortion, morality laws, and why scientists and artists often lean liberal. The central theme is how evidence, funding, and upbringing shape public beliefs, and how fake controversy can distort science-related policy debates.
Main Topics: Science education vs. religion and politics (Priority: 5/5): The conversation argues that science should be taught in science classes, while religion belongs elsewhere. They warn that 'multiple views' language can be used either honestly or as a cover for anti-evolution agendas. Political influence on science funding (Priority: 5/5): Tyson challenges the idea of a broad 'war on science' by noting that science funding has often been higher under Republican presidents, though modern partisan rhetoric can still undermine science in practice. Fake controversy and climate science (Priority: 5/5): A major theme is that politicians and media can amplify uncertainty or fringe dissent to create the impression of scientific controversy, especially around climate change. Morality, law, and evidence-based policy (Priority: 4/5): Maher and the hosts discuss death penalty, abortion, prostitution, marijuana, and assisted suicide, framing them as issues where policy should rely on evidence rather than ideology. Political and cultural identity formation (Priority: 3/5): They explore how childhood education, family culture, and regional upbringing shape beliefs, and how living near cities often correlates with more liberal views. Why scientists and artists skew liberal (Priority: 4/5): The discussion suggests that academics, artists, and scientists tend to favor open-minded, progressive positions, though both Maher and Grinspoon note that conservatives also have valid historical and intellectual traditions. Astrobiology and planetary protection (Priority: 4/5): Grinspoon explains that astrobiology includes ethical concerns about protecting potential Martian life and avoiding contamination, connecting scientific practice to moral responsibility.
Key Arguments: Science class should focus on science, and religion should not be inserted as doctrine; only genuinely honest presentation of multiple viewpoints is acceptable. Scientific disagreement is normal and necessary, but political actors can exploit it to manufacture the appearance of equal controversy where there is none. Claims of a Republican 'war on science' are incomplete without looking at actual funding levels, which Tyson says have historically been higher under Republican presidents. Modern anti-science rhetoric is linked more to recent partisan extremism than to the full historical Republican tradition. Policy on issues like marijuana, abortion, and the death penalty should be informed by evidence, not just moral assertion. Scientists should help make laws more evidence-based without dictating personal morality. Artists and academics tend to be more liberal because their work rewards creativity, open-mindedness, and skepticism of rigid orthodoxy. Astrobiology adds an ethical dimension to the search for life by emphasizing forward and backward contamination risks and the value of potential extraterrestrial biospheres.
